Output ee60d8d6527d7905b0e1582cdfc424a92cc95dbde823bdba1af5faeb54bece12:116

value
88980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cb657bb8fd7cac6decf292f437428aad1e00cf7 OP_EQUALVERIFY OP_CHECKSIG
address
1Dq23FUXREWJEASA3UkwLQECKV4shHyFyf
transaction
ee60d8d6527d7905b0e1582cdfc424a92cc95dbde823bdba1af5faeb54bece12
confirmations
133523
spent
true